The Interconnectedness of Sleep and Pain

How Sleep Affects Pain Perception

Physiological Changes

Sleep plays a vital role in the body’s ability to heal and recover. During deep sleep, the body undergoes processes that repair tissues, regulate hormones, and modulate pain pathways. Lack of sleep can lead to increased sensitivity to pain, as evidenced by studies showing that sleep deprivation heightens activity in the brain regions responsible for processing pain signals.

Inflammatory Response

Poor sleep quality can trigger inflammatory responses in the body, increasing levels of pro-inflammatory cytokines. Elevated inflammation is a known contributor to various chronic pain conditions, including arthritis and fibromyalgia.

Cognitive Factors:

Sleep deprivation can impair cognitive function, leading to difficulties in concentrating and decision-making. This can exacerbate feelings of helplessness or anxiety related to chronic pain, further amplifying the perception of discomfort.

Bidirectional Relationship

The relationship between sleep and pain is bidirectional; not only does poor sleep affect pain perception, but chronic pain can also disrupt sleep patterns:

Pain-Induced Sleep Disturbances

 Individuals suffering from chronic pain often experience difficulty falling asleep or staying asleep due to discomfort. This disruption can lead to a vicious cycle where poor sleep exacerbates pain, which in turn leads to even poorer sleep quality.

Sleep Disorders

Conditions such as insomnia and sleep apnea are common among individuals with chronic pain. These disorders can further complicate treatment efforts and diminish overall quality of life.

Evidence Supporting the Sleep-Pain Connection

Numerous studies have explored the relationship between sleep quality and pain perception:

Research Findings

:A study published in *The Journal of Neuroscience* found that participants who were deprived of sleep exhibited a 120% increase in activity in their somatosensory cortex—the area responsible for processing pain—compared to when they had a full night’s rest. This indicates that lack of sleep can lower pain thresholds and increase sensitivity to painful stimuli.

Chronic Pain Population

Research has shown that individuals with chronic conditions such as fibromyalgia or arthritis often report significant disturbances in sleep quality. A systematic review indicated that those with chronic low back pain experienced worse sleep quality compared to those without pain, highlighting the pervasive impact of discomfort on rest.

Psychological Factors

Studies have demonstrated that individuals with chronic pain who experience poor sleep are more likely to suffer from depression and anxiety. The interplay between these factors creates a complex web that complicates treatment approaches.

The Importance of Sleep Hygiene

Given the profound impact of sleep on pain perception, establishing good sleep hygiene is essential for managing chronic pain effectively. Sleep hygiene refers to practices that promote consistent and restorative sleep.

Key Practices for Improving Sleep Quality

Maintain a Regular Sleep Schedule

Going to bed and waking up at the same time each day helps regulate the body’s internal clock, improving overall sleep quality.

Create a Comfortable Sleep Environment:

A dark, quiet, and cool bedroom can enhance sleep quality. Consider using blackout curtains, earplugs, or white noise machines to minimize disruptions.

Limit Stimulants

Avoiding caffeine and nicotine several hours before bedtime is crucial for improving sleep quality. Additionally, reducing alcohol consumption is important as it can disrupt normal sleep patterns.

Establish a Relaxing Bedtime Routine

Engaging in calming activities before bed—such as reading or practicing relaxation techniques—can signal to the body that it’s time to wind down.

Physical Activity: 

Regular physical activity promotes better sleep; however, exercising too close to bedtime may have the opposite effect for some individuals.

Mindfulness Practice

Techniques such as mindfulness meditation or deep breathing exercises can help reduce stress levels and promote relaxation before bedtime.

Integrating Sleep Management into Pain Treatment Plans

To effectively manage chronic pain through improved sleep quality, healthcare providers should consider integrating sleep management strategies into treatment plans:

Assessment Tools

 Utilizing standardized assessment tools like the Pittsburgh Sleep Quality Index (PSQI) can help identify patients experiencing sleep disturbances related to their chronic pain conditions.

Educating Patients

 Providing education about the relationship between sleep and pain empowers patients to take an active role in managing their health effectively.

Collaborative Care Models

Engaging with mental health professionals or sleep specialists can enhance treatment plans by addressing psychological factors related to both pain and sleep disturbances.

Behavioral Interventions

Cognitive-behavioral therapy for insomnia (CBT-I) has been shown effective in treating both insomnia and associated chronic pain conditions by addressing maladaptive thoughts and behaviors related to sleep.
